According to a recent report by real estate consultant Vestian, the fresh supply of office space in the top seven cities has seen a 4% decline in the July-September quarter. The data further reveals a significant 26% decrease in Pune alone.

The supply of office space in the top seven cities has declined by 4% in the July-September quarter.
Pune experienced the most significant drop, with a 26% decrease in new office space supply.
The decrease in supply has led to an increase in rental prices in some cities, making it more expensive for tenants.
Businesses are exploring co-working spaces, flexible office solutions, and other cost-effective options to reduce their operational costs.
Economic growth, government policies, and technological advancements are key factors that will shape the future of the office space market.
